Come trasferire i file al e dal vostro telefono nokia con Linux Ubuntu agosto 26, 2007
Inviato da mimo in : Linux , trackback
Questa guida si applica a qualuque distribuzione linux (con le dovute accortezze) ed a qualunque telefono nokia symbian serie N serie E e serie 6xxx.
Ognuno di noi ha un telefono cellulare che è estremamente veloce. Con esso possiamo andare su internet, registrare video, ricevere e mandare MMS ed SMS oppure e-mail, ascoltare mp3 e radio. In altre parole: il telefono cellulare sta diventando uno degli accessori più indispensabili per ciascuno di noi. Ho scritto quindi questa guida, per trasferire i file dal vostro telefono al vostro computer e viceversa.
La guida a colpo d’occhio può sembrare lunga, ma per fare tutto non vi saranno necessari più di dieci minuti.
Io l’ho provata sul mio (Nokia 6681), se qualcuno di voi la prova su un altro modello, mi dica che ne pensa!
Allora, il problema con i telefoni cellulari che usano la Pop-port, è che quando colleghiamo il cellulare USB con il nostro PC linux, non succede niente. Penso che molti di voi (come me), magari abbiano provato a montare il dispositivo, oppure ad aspettare che si montasse da solo, come in genere succede nella maggior parte dei dispositivi USB: la fotocamera, l’hard disk esterno, il lettore mp3, l’iPod….. ma, naturalmente non succedeva nulla.
Vediamo allora come fare per risolvere questo fastidioso inconveniente comune a tutte le nostre disto.
Primo passo: installiamo il software necessario.
Apriamo il gestore pacchetti synaptic, (sistema -> amministrazione -> gestore pacchetti synaptic )
e cerchiamo questi due pacchetti:
- obexftp
- openobex-apps
Se qualche altro pacchetto, dovesse dipendere da questi due, allora installiamoli, facendo click su “marca” e quindi sul bottone “applica”.Quando l’installazione finisce, possiamo chiudere synaptic.
Ora, il software che abbiamo installato è tool basato sulla console, quindi noi installeremo ora una bella interfaccia grafica, che ci renderà la vita più semplice! Il programmino in questione si chiama ObexFTP Front-end, e per giunta non richiede nemmeno l’installazione! Scarichiamo il file da qui, e scegliamo il primo mirror (quello in formato .zip), ed estraiamo il contenuto nella nostra home directory (non sul desktop!!)
Secondo passo: configurazione.
Apriamo il terminale, (Applicazioni -> accessori -> terminale) quindi:
Digitiamo sul terminale questo comando:
~$ lsusb
e riceviamo quindi una lista dei dispositivi come questesta:
Bus 002 Device 001: ID 0000:0000
Bus 001 Device 005: ID 0421:0422 Nokia Mobile Phones
Bus 001 Device 003: ID 046d:c505 Logitech, Inc. Cordless Mouse+Keyboard Receiver
Bus 001 Device 001: ID 0000:0000
A questo punto, nel mio caso almeno, è stato subito riconosciuto il telefonino Nokia, che sta sulla seconda riga, ve la riporto per comodità:
Bus 001 Device 005: ID 0421:0422 Nokia Mobile Phones
Questa riga contiene il VendorID del dispositivo, ovvero il “nome in codice” del produttore (in questo caso Nokia) ed il productID, che non è altro che un codice che dice quale modello abbiamo di quel certo produttore.
Con il nokia, dovremmo aver tutti lo stesso codice cioè 0421(almeno in teoria) e ProductID diversi, in base al modello: il mio è un Nokia 6681, ed ha
VendorID = 0421
ProductID = 0422
se avessimo un N70 avremmo come ProductID 043a, ecc ecc
A questo punto, facciamo copia-incolla di questa riga sul terminale:
sudo gedit /etc/udev/rules.d/040-permissions.rules
dopo aver inserito la password di amministratori, avremo davanti Gedit con un file vuoto.
Andiamo ad inserire le righe:
BUS=="usb", SYSFS{idVendor}=="VendorID", SYSFS{idProduct}=="ProductID", GROUP="plugdev", USER="NomeUtente"
avendo cura di sostituire VendorID, ProductID e NomeUtente con quanto trovato prima attraverso il comanso lsusb. Nel mio caso dovrò scrivere quindi:
BUS=="usb", SYSFS{idVendor}=="0421", SYSFS{idProduct}=="0422", GROUP="plugdev", USER="maurizio"
Facciamo click su un punto vuoto del desktop con il tasto destro, e quindi selezioniamo crea icona di avvio:
![]()
A questo punto ci appare una nuova finestra, che dovremo impostare così:
![]()
scrivendo nel campo “comando” questo:
java -jar /home/NOMEUTENTE/obexftp-frontend-0.6.1-bin/OBEXFTPFrontend.jar
ed avendo cura di sostituire NOMEUTENTE con il vostro. L’icona che ho usato si chiama “gnome-palm-conduict” e la trovate nel menù che si attiva facendo click su “nessuna icona” nella finestra di creazione del collegamento(in alto sulla sinistra).
Tutto quello che ci rimane da fare adesso, è un doppio click sul collegamento appena creato, e quindi ObexFTP Front-end ci apparirà e potremo configurarlo, seguendo il prossimo passo:
1. Mettiamo /usr/bin/obexftp sul campo “path field” di ObexFTP.
2. Selezioniamo USB sull’opzione Transport e mettiamo il valore nel campo ad 1, come ho riportato nel mio screenshot:
Per chiudere la finestra di configurazione, facciamo click su OK quando abbiamo fatto tutto. Facciamo click adesso sulla prima icona che sta nella finestra principale: adesso il drive C: e la memory card del telefono le potete “vedere” ed è possibile, ora, trasferire file dal telefono al computer e viceversa!








































Commenti»
Appena ho tempo ci provo… chissà che finalmente non riesca a far funzionare il mio nokia 5200 via bluetooth con ubuntu…
il nokia 5200 non credo sia symbian
ottima guida, il programma funziona benissimo. Grazie!
non mi funziona: creata l’icona di avvio, apre ma la videata della configurazione è vuota; si apre la finestra Configuration ma è completamente vuota. se chiudo e riapro la finestra configuration si ripresenta lo stesso “vuoto”
Hi all!
It’s very nice to see that my project – ObexFTP front-end – is helping so many people! When I started coding it I never imagined that it would happen.
But, anyway… I am very happy to know that ObexFTP front-end is useful to you!
Cheers,
Daniel.
ragazzi pur seguendo tutto alla lettera se clicco sull’icona che ho creato non succede proprio nulla…
neanche dopo aver riavviato…
chi può venirmi in soccorso?
grazie
tomm
come sopra….cioè non succede nulla….
provate ad usare la stringa che scrivete nel collegamento sul terminale, e vedete se vi restituisce qualche errore.
Il programma parte senza problemi, con le impostazioni corrette. Cliccando sull’icona però mi appare: “The following command has failed: Listing files under the / folder”
ho ubuntu 7.10 a 64bit, pur avendo seguito tutto alla lettera, cliccando sull’icona creata non succede nulla.
provando la stringa sul terminale l’errore è “Unable to access jarfile /home/NOMEUTENTE/obexftp-frontend-0.6.1-bin/OBEXFTPFrontend.jar
facendo partire il file manualmente con java 32 bit, parte, ma mmm….. pur configurando il frontend come sopra il mio N70 non si connette…….. dove sbaglio?
scusa la critica, am ti devo dire che questa guida è incompleta
e non si capiscono alcune cose:
1) non dici che bisogna installarsi anche il frontend di obexftp
io ho dovuto cercarlo su internet trovandolo inpacchettato .deb e dopo che l’ho installato me lo sono trovato tra i miei programmi e non c’è stato bisogno di fare l’icona di lancio.
2) il file che ci fai fare con gedit “peermission”, una volta salvato che ci si deve fare?
ora a me il front-end mi dice :
“Listing file under the folder” e li mi fermo….
potete aiutarmi?
risolto.
è bastato resettare , il computer, e ora funziona tutto.
[...] [Fonte:mimo] [...]
In risposta a Tore e al problema “The following command has failed: Listing files under the / folder”.
Ho avuto lo stesso problema e nel mio caso era una questione di permessi. Lanciando la gui da root funziona tutto:
gksu “java -jar /home/NOMEUTENTE/obexftp-frontend-0.6.1-bin/OBEXFTPFrontend.jar”
oppure usando sudo.
Credo che ci sia qualcosa di storto nel file /etc/udev/rules.d/040-permissions.rules. Una volta sistemato dovrei riuscire ad accedere al telefono anche senza privilegi di root
[...] Tra un paio di settimane arriverà la nuova versione di Gnome: la 2.22.0. Oggi, però, è uscita intanto GNOME 2.21.92, che rappresenta la release candidate per la futuro rilascio definitivo. L’annuncio del rilascio, le note, i link di download ed i sorgenti sono disponibili sulla mailing list di gnome, qui: gnome-announce-list. Una novità su tutte: integrazione del backend ObexFTP per GVFS, che permetterà di “navigare” nel telefonino via USB, senza seguire “strane guide“. [...]
Si ottimo io con nokia 5200 tutto bene si connette al volo